Should young children be subject to passive smoking?



The question about whether young people should be subject to passive smoking (or “second hand smoke” (SHS)) soon resolves an issue of the rights of the child or the responsibilities of the parent. A person may wish to exert autonomy over their desire to have a cigarette, but does his or her child have an overriding right not to be subject of that smoke? As is usual with the law, the judgment crucially deciding upon conflicting interests, and balancing their decisions to make an apt decision. Ethicists have long wondered who exactly confers these rights, how are they defined and on what basis (Hall, 2005)

In fact, it is tempting to believe that UK health policy exists in a total vacuum, when it comes to the outside world. This is in fact not true, because the UK is a signatory to the United Nations Convention on the Rights of the Child (UNCRC). Although UN Conventions do not have  ‘the force of law’, countries do report at regular intervals to the relevant UN Committee on their progress in implementation. From a legal point, it is noteworthy that the UNCRC does not have the same force as the Human Rights Act, although it is widely quoted in policy documents (Hagger, 2005). The concept of “rights’” cannot change human behaviour, but it “adds an element of accountability and a legal framework that can be used to make governments wake up to their obligations to make things happen’”. (Hall, 2005)

Smoking, lung disease and policy

A very recent study has looked in fact at the relationship between childhood environmental tobacco smoke (ETS) exposure and the development of subsequent lung disease (Lovasi et al. 2010) Mechanical stress to alveolar walls, the little units which make up our lungs, may cause progressive damage after an early-life insult such as exposure to environmental tobacco smoke. Childhood ETS exposure was assessed retrospectively as a report of living with one or more regular indoor smokers. Childhood ETS exposure was associated with detectable differences on computed tomography scans of adult lungs of nonsmokers.

Indeed, young children who are exposed to tobacco smoke are in general significantly more likely to develop health problems during childhood and in later life. who are exposed to second-hand smoke (Health Care Commission (2006), ATS (1999). Although parental smoking is the commonest source of ETS exposure to children, children are also unfortunately exposed to ETS in schools, restaurants, public places and public transport vehicles.

Apart from containing thousands of chemicals, the particle size in the ETS is much smaller than the main stream smoke, and therefore has a greater penetrability in the airways of children. Exposure to ETS has been shown to be associated with increased prevalence of upper respiratory tract infections, wheeze, asthma and lower respiratory tract infections. Therefore, arguably, an increased awareness of the harmful effects of ETS on children’s health is warranted for formulating health policy overall (Cheraghi and Salvi, 2009). Furthermore, specifically, environmental tobacco smoke exposure carries a number of risks for the developing lung of the fetus, infant and child. (Wallace, 2009)

Despite the recent campaigns to eliminate smoking and hinder the detrimental effects of passive smoking , actual smoking rates still increase worldwide. Several physiological systems, with the respiratory being the primary, are disrupted by PS and progressively deteriorate through chronic exposures. This is of particular importance in children, given that respiratory complications during childhood can be transferred to adulthood, lead to significantly inferior health profiles. (Metsios, Flouris, and Koutedakis 2009).

SHS exposure is a known cause of disease among non-smokers, contributing to lung cancer, heart disease, and sudden infant death syndrome, as well as other diseases. Yet thousands of children remain unprotected from exposure to SHS in private homes and cars. New initiatives targeting SHS in these spaces have raised ethical questions about imposing constraints on private behaviours (Jarvis and Malone, 2008) In the countries where the smoke free legislation was successfully implemented (Ireland, Italy, Scotland) there is evidence of reduced prevalence of the smoking induced diseases, especially acute coronary attacks (Kemp, 2009).

Summary

One would, arguably, want to follow one’s intuitions and to see a society where children’s lungs are not damaged to the actions of their parents or adults generally. However, the whole issue brings up the added problems of whether second-hand smoke or passive smoking does without doubt cause lung problems (is science infallible?) and, as a country, whether we can do anything other than ‘encourage opportunities’ rather than to ‘enforce rights’. It is not an electoral issue, however, and nor is it likely to become one. It might become, on the other hand, a very campaigning issue for charities such as the British Lung Foundation and the British Heart Foundation.
